Transaction 91ab6996b3f321b60ecd13d73aba444a8b226f7c901211a9324e5aff3f60fb50

1 Input
2 Outputs
  • 91ab6996b3f321b60ecd13d73aba444a8b226f7c901211a9324e5aff3f60fb50:0
  • value  500000
    address  3D3xGyUWAqPnoCYyLhDUEdqAgTaf2SdaRs
  • 91ab6996b3f321b60ecd13d73aba444a8b226f7c901211a9324e5aff3f60fb50:1
  • value  5681410
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p